- March 9, 1966Accident
The crew departed Đà Nẵng Airport on a supply mission to the A Shau Special Forces Camp. While flying at low height, the aircraft was hit by enemy fire. The right engine was on fire and later detached. The pilot-in-command elected to make an emergency landing in the valley. Three crew members were able to evacuate the area while three others were killed by enemy soldiers. Crew: Cpt Willard Marioins Collins, † 1st Lt Delbert Ray Peterson, † 1st Lt J. L. Meek, S/Sgt J. G.
